Oil furnace rep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ues that prevent an oil-fired heating system from functioning properly. Technicians inspect components such as the burner, fuel lines, filters, and thermostats to identify any faults or malfunctions. Repairs may include cleaning or replacing dirty or damaged parts, adjusting controls for optimal performance, and resolving issues like inconsistent heating or system shutdowns. Proper repair ensures the furnace operates efficiently, providing reliable warmth during colder months.

These services help resolve common problems such as pilot light failures, fuel leaks, or ignition issues that can compromise the furnace’s ability to heat a property effectively. Over time, wear and tear, dirt buildup, or outdated parts can lead to decreased efficiency or system breakdowns. Oil furnace repair specialists work to restore proper operation, reduce energy waste, and prevent more costly repairs or complete system failures. This proactive approach helps maintain consistent indoor comfort and extends the lifespan of the heating equipment.

Cost of Oil Furnace Repair - Typical repair costs can range from $200 to $600, depending on the complexity of the issue. For example, replacing a faulty thermostat might cost around $250, while fixing a major component could be closer to $550.

Factors Influencing Costs - The overall expense varies based on the specific repair needed and the furnace’s age and model. Minor repairs tend to be less expensive, whereas extensive repairs can approach or exceed $1,000 in some cases.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for oil furnace repairs generally range from $75 to $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the repair’s duration and the local service provider’s rates.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include replacement parts such as valves or burners, which can add $50 to $300 to the total. These expenses vary based on the parts required and their availability.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my oil furnace needs repair? Signs include unusual noises, inconsistent heating, increased fuel consumption, or frequent cycling. If these issues are noticed, contacting a local service provider is recommended for an assessment.

What are common oil furnace problems? Common issues include ignition failure, clogged filters, thermostat malfunctions, and pump problems. A professional technician can diagnose and address these concerns.

How often should an oil furnace be serviced? Regular servicing is typically recommended annually to ensure proper operation and efficiency. Contact local pros for maintenance options tailored to specific needs.

Can repairs be done on older oil furnaces? Yes, many repairs are possible on older units, but a professional can evaluate whether repair or replacement is more cost-effective based on the condition of the furnace.
